Skip to content
当前页面

末级分光器箱体二维码资源号质检

功能简介

检测末级分光器箱体中的二维码资源号标签,识别标签上的内容,并与提供的信息进行比对,返回被检测的图片是否是否为全景照、是否清晰以及标签内容与供稽核的内容是否一致的信息。 enter description hereenter description hereenter description here

应用场景

使用深度学习技术实现末级分光器箱体中二维码资源号稽核任务,能够极大地减少稽核任务中所需的人力,提高稽核的效率。

AI 能力集成

  • 外部应用最多只需调用两个接口,就可以完成一次 AI 能力集成,对不同图像识别能力,接口是固定的:其一是识别能力接口,其二是用户反馈接口

识别能力接口

  • 接口说明

    实现末级分光器箱体中的二维码资源号标签的检测,识别标签上的内容,并与提供的信息进行比对,返回被检测的图片是否是否为全景照、是否清晰以及标签内容与供稽核的内容是否一致的信息。

  • 接口 URL

    https://aicp.teamshub.com/sitech/aiopen/mojiocr

  • 访问方式

    POST

  • 接口头部参数

    Content-Type:application/json token:"token" 注:可用的 token 需要联系管理员进行申请

  • Body 参数
{
         {
                "image": [base64,base64…….],
                "orderAttr": [{bianma:"xxx","dizhi":"xxx"},{bianma:"xxx","dizhi":"xxx"}…….]
         }
}
  • 请求参数说明
入参名称参数类型是否必须参数说明
imagestringtrue图像base64编码,可以单张或者批量,批量每个不超过20张
orderAttrstringtrue传入稽核信息的字典数组,包含图像的资源信息,每个字典包含“bianma”和“dizhi”两个key,”bianma”表示编码资源,”dizhi”表示地址资源
  • 返回参数
{
    "flag": true,
    "resultCode": 0,
    "message": "系统处理正常",
    "data": {
        "traceId": "8065853997725466624",
        "serialNumber": "8065853997725466624",
        "capabilityId": "mojiocr",
        "results": {
            "words_result": [
                {
                    "10010": "合格-箱体外全景照齐全且清晰",
                    "10024": "规范-有喷码且资源一致"
                },
                {
                    "10010": "合格-箱体外全景照齐全且清晰",
                    "10024": "规范-有喷码且资源一致"
                }
            ],
            "status": "0001:正常识别.0001:正常识别."
        }
    }
}
  • 返回参数说明
参数名称参数类型是否必须参数说明
flagBooleantrue请求返回状态
resultCodeInttrue请求返回状态码
messageStringtrue请求返回提示
dataJsonObjecttrue请求返回数据

用户反馈接口

  • 接口说明

    末级分光器箱体二维码资源号质检结果经过用户(可能修改)确认后被提交到本接口,进行入库。

    • 调用 URL:

      https://aicp.teamshub.com/feedback/sitech/feedbackInformation

      Header:

      参数
      Content-Typeapplication/json
      tokenstring

      调用方法:

      post

      请求参数:

      参数名类型是否必选参数说明
      serialNumberString业务流水号
      jobNumberString业务工单号
      informationString用户修正信息(转义的 json 字符串,每个能力不同)
      modifyFlagBoolean修改标记(true 已修改,false 未修改)
      feedbackFlagBoolean反馈标识 (true 为正确,false 为错误)
      timeString工单发生时间,不填默认查当天

      请求报文示例:

       {
        "serialNumber":"8063200944317145088",
        "jobNumber":"test_jobNumber",
         "time":"2021-03-25",
         "modifyFlag":true,
         "feedbackFlag":false,
         "information":"{}"
      }
      

      返回值描述:

      参数名类型参数说明
      flagBoolean成功标识
      resultCodeLong状态码
      messageString返回信息
      dataJSON返回结果
      serialNumberString业务流水号

      成功返回示例:

      {
         "flag": true,
         "resultCode": 0,
         "message": "系统处理正常",
         "data": {
             "xxx":""
         }
      }
      

      失败返回示例:

      {
          "flag": false,
          "resultCode": 1,
          "message": "服务端报错",
          "data": null
      }
      

文档中心